The modern accounts receivable (AR) department in an organization acts as the primary hub for collecting on debt, reducing overdue payments, and increasing working capital. Depending on the size and scope of the company, the AR function can encompass all or more of the following areas:

•  Credit application processing
•  Preparing/Distributing invoices
•  Developing and executing collection strategy
•  Dispute settlement
•  Payment processing and reconciliation
•  Cash flow forecasting
                                                                                                                                              

Accounts Receivable Challenges and Opportunities

Manual tasks such as responding to customer service requests and account reconciliations take up the majority of the time allocated for credit and collections. Prioritizing customer follow up calls, tracking down all the details needed for those calls, and resolving disputes requires vast amounts of staff time and energy. Too often there’s no time left to focus on critical revenue-driving activities.
